Utilizing Social Media to Boost Visibility
Whoever said that social media and B2B machinery don’t mix, clearly hasn’t seen the actually pretty cool videos of manufacturing processes, the impressive before-and-after project photos, or the engaging discussions happening in industry-specific LinkedIn groups. In the digital age, social media has become an invaluable tool for machinery manufacturers looking to boost their visibility and connect with their audience.
Social media platforms offer machinery manufacturers a unique opportunity to not only showcase their products but also tell their story. These platforms enable you to demonstrate your industry expertise, share updates about your business, and engage directly with customers and prospects. Plus, they are an excellent channel for customer service and feedback.
Different social media platforms offer different advantages, and it’s essential to understand these to leverage each platform effectively.
LinkedIn, often considered the go-to platform for B2B marketing, can be a goldmine for machinery manufacturers. It’s a fantastic platform to share industry insights, network with professionals, participate in relevant groups, and establish your business as a thought leader. You can share content about your latest machinery, industry trends, case studies, and more.
Instagram and Facebook, on the other hand, are excellent platforms for showcasing your machinery in action. You can share photos and videos from your production line, highlight before-and-after scenarios from your customers, and even give behind-the-scenes peeks into your company culture. These platforms are more visual and are great for storytelling.
Let’s consider an example of a successful social media campaign in the machinery industry. Caterpillar, one of the world’s leading machinery manufacturers, launched the #BuiltForIt campaign, where they showcased their equipment performing challenging tasks in visually stunning scenarios. The videos not only highlighted the robustness of their machinery but were also highly shareable, resulting in increased brand visibility and engagement.
